Baton Rouge Redstorm top MesaGreyHairs, 427.5-382.0

Baton Rouge Redstorm scored a hard-fought victory over MesaGreyHairs, emerging victorious with a 427.5-382.0 win. Baton Rouge Redstorm earned an early 17.5-point lead on Saturday behind Derwin James (19 points) and Keenan Allen (16). MesaGreyHairs came back to take the lead late afternoon Sunday, powered by Jared Goff (44 points) and Michael Thomas (43). Unphased, Baton Rouge Redstorm got it going later that night, as Patrick Mahomes (67 points) and Tyreek Hill (21) put them back on top once and for all. This marks the first time this season Baton Rouge Redstorm have gotten the best of MesaGreyHairs, after falling 385-370 in their last matchup. Baton Rouge Redstorm end the season at 12-3, while MesaGreyHairs finish the campaign at 13-2.
